I don't think this has been posted here: Aldershot Town are planning a development of their ground:

Phase 1
  • Replacement of East, West and South Stands and new toilet blocks
  • Refurbishment of the North Stand [where the players' tunnel is] and club building
  • New floodlights
  • Creation of space for future fan zone around stadium entrance
Phase 2
  • New hospitality and community building on the High Street
  • Refurbishment of the Phoenix Lounge
  • Landscaping and public realm works on the High Street
Phase 3
  • Replacement of North Stand
  • Renovation of facilities including hospitality, administrative offices and players accommodation
  • New pitch
